Online Class Availability at West Kentucky Community and Technical College
Many students take online classes at West Kentucky Community and Technical College. Among 5,274 students, 1,354 (26%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,189 (23%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Health Sciences & Services Graduates from West Kentucky Community and Technical College
Those who finish West Kentucky Community and Technical College’s Health Sciences & Services program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$16,086 |
| 2 years | $19,835 |
| 3 years | $20,975 |
| 4 years | $29,462 |
| 5 years | $33,019 |
How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? At the four-year mark, Health Sciences & Services graduates from West Kentucky Community and Technical College report median earnings of $29,462, compared with $38,565 for all West Kentucky Community and Technical College graduates — about 24% lower than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
The median debt for Health Sciences & Services graduates from West Kentucky Community and Technical College is $8,500.
